Kaunas climate

Kaunas is warmest in July, with average highs of 23 °C, and coldest in February, when nights average -5.4 °C. July is the wettest month (85 mm) and February the driest (38 mm). Figures are 1991–2020 climate normals.

Across a full year Kaunas averages 660 mm of rain, 22 days above 25 °C and 113 days below freezing.

What to expectKaunas through the year

Kaunas has a clear annual cycle: average daily highs run from 0.2 °C in February to 23 °C in July, a swing of 22 °C in mean temperature across the year.

Counted across a normal year, 22 days a year reach 25 °C, 2 of them reach 30 °C, 113 nights drop below freezing. The warmest reading in the 1991–2020 record is 34 °C, in June.

Rain is strongly seasonal. July averages 85 mm against 38 mm in February — 2.2 times as much. Planning around the dry months matters more here than planning around temperature.

QuestionsCommon questions about Kaunas’s climate

When is the best time to visit Kaunas?

That depends on what you want, so the honest answer is a comparison rather than a single month. June, July, August sit closest to 20 °C on average, July is the warmest month and February the driest. The month-by-month table above has the full picture.

How hot does Kaunas get?

In July, the warmest month, daily highs average 23 °C. About 2 days a year pass 30 °C. The highest value in the 1991–2020 record is 34 °C.

How cold does it get in winter?

Nights average -5.4 °C in February, the coldest month. A normal year has 113 nights below freezing.

Which month is wettest in Kaunas?

July, averaging 85 mm over 12 days with rain. The driest month is February with 38 mm. The year as a whole averages 660 mm.

Are these figures a forecast?

No. They are 1991–2020 climate normals: the average of thirty years, which describes what a month is usually like in Kaunas rather than what any particular week will bring. Individual years can differ substantially from the normal.
